Salvia greggii

Family Labiatae
Plant Type herbaceous perennial
Zone USDA:   7a - 9b   RHS:   H - FH   EGF:   H3 - H5   Australia:   1 - 3  
Care Level
Height 30 - 50 cm (12 - 20 in)
Spread 30 - 50 cm (12 - 20 in)
Light full sun
Soil Moisture low, well-drained
Soil Type loam to sandy
Soil pH acidic to alkaline

Description Salvia greggii (autumn sage) bears showy, bright red and repeat-blooming blossoms during early summer to late autumn. This herbaceous perennial is clump forming and has medium green foliage that is matte, medium textured and semi-evergreen.
Typical Uses Bedding plant, border and wild flower.
Special Characteristics Hummingbirds are attracted to Salvia greggii . Salvia greggii is tolerant of drought.
Cautions With its fast growth rate, Salvia greggii (autumn sage) will reach its mature size quickly. Keep this in mind when planning the layout of your garden. Reaching maturity quickly can be a benefit if you want your garden to look more established sooner.
